Power and Performance

Both crossovers offer different approaches to powertrain engineering. The Kia Seltos base model produces 146 horsepower from its engine, while the 2025 Mazda CX-30 delivers 191 horsepower from its SKYACTIV®-G 2.5-liter inline four-cylinder engine. This 31% power advantage becomes apparent during highway merging and passing situations.

Transmission choices also differ significantly between these vehicles. While the Kia Seltos utilizes a continuously variable transmission that can feel disconnected during acceleration, the six-speed automatic transmission in the Mazda CX-30 provides crisp, instinctive shifts that enhance driver confidence and control.

Capability

Traction management systems represent a key differentiator between these compact crossovers. The Kia Seltos offers all-wheel drive as an available option on select trims, with most configurations featuring front-wheel drive as standard equipment. In contrast, every 2025 Mazda CX-30 includes i-Activ AWD® as standard equipment across all trim levels.

The technological approaches also differ substantially. While the Kia Seltos all-wheel drive system responds after traction loss occurs, the new Mazda model’s i-Activ AWD® monitors road conditions 200 times per second and redistributes power before wheel slip begins. This proactive approach maintains control during challenging weather conditions rather than reacting to problems after they develop.

Safety Technology

Independent safety testing reveals meaningful differences between these vehicles' protection capabilities. While both crossovers offer standard safety features, the 2025 Mazda CX-30 earned the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ety TOP SAFETY PICK+ award — recognition achieved by fewer than 15% of tested vehicles. The Kia Seltos has not received this distinction.
